Fashion For Life is over and we forge onwards.
Posted in Uncategorized on March 23, 2011 | 1 Comment »
Fashion for Life has finally closed, the wonderous grayscale sims are gone, leaving behind them a legacy of a truly amazing 4.7 million Linden dollars raised for the American Cancer Society; an impressive start to the Relay For Life of Second Life season. Kafka Comes to Caledon
Posted in Business issues, Caledon, Education, Events, Problems on March 20, 2011 | 6 Comments »
Many of you may have heard of Caledon Oxbridge. Originally part of the Linden Lab Community Gateway programme, even since that has been closed, Oxbridge has continued its mission to help new residents with instructions, classes, freebies and even accommodation.
